1857557284310787020473695169290
Even
1857557284310787020473695169290 is even
Previous even number is 1857557284310787020473695169288
Next even number is 1857557284310787020473695169292
Cubed
6409536822907909807412069026244161217210640309065822991143593385586783261180551648233089000
Squared
3450519064496066043403727756315422237048456345008681759104100
Binary
10111011100100001011101011111010011100100110100101100001011101101100101010111001001110110101100001010